Запитання з тегом «python»

Python - це багатопарадигма, динамічно набрана, багатоцільова мова програмування. Він призначений для швидкого вивчення, розуміння та використання та використання чистого та єдиного синтаксису. Зверніть увагу, що Python 2 офіційно не підтримується станом на 01-01-2020. Тим не менш, для питань, пов’язаних з версією Python, додайте тег [python-2.7] або [python-3.x]. Використовуючи варіант або бібліотеку Python (наприклад, Jython, PyPy, Pandas, Numpy), будь ласка, включіть його до тегів.



21
Що робить ** (подвійна зірка / зірочка) та * (зірка / зірочка) для параметрів?
На цей питання є відповіді на Stack Overflow на російському : Що значить * (звёздочка) і ** подвійне звёздочка в Питоне? У наступних визначеннях методів, для чого *і що потрібно **робити param2? def foo(param1, *param2): def bar(param1, **param2):


19
Перетворити байти в рядок
Я використовую цей код, щоб отримати стандартний вихід із зовнішньої програми: >>> from subprocess import * >>> command_stdout = Popen(['ls', '-l'], stdout=PIPE).communicate()[0] Метод communication () повертає масив байтів: >>> command_stdout b'total 0\n-rw-rw-r-- 1 thomas thomas 0 Mar 3 07:03 file1\n-rw-rw-r-- 1 thomas thomas 0 Mar 3 07:03 file2\n' Однак я …
2306 python  string  python-3.x 

30
Як розділити список на шматки рівномірного розміру?
У мене є список довільної довжини, і мені потрібно розділити його на шматки рівних розмірів і оперувати ним. Є кілька очевидних способів зробити це, як збереження лічильника та двох списків, і коли другий список заповнюється, додайте його до першого списку та очистіть другий список для наступного раунду даних, але це …
2264 python  list  split  chunks 


27
Як розібрати рядок до float чи int?
Як в Python я можу проаналізувати числовий рядок, як "545.2222"його відповідне значення float 545.2222,? Або проаналізувати рядок "31"на ціле число 31,? Я просто хочу знати, як проаналізувати float str до a floatта (окремо) int str to an int.

20
Перетворення рядка в дату
У мене величезний список дат, таких як рядки: Jun 1 2005 1:33PM Aug 28 1999 12:00AM Я збираюсь засунути ці дані назад у відповідні поля дат у базі даних, тому мені потрібно вписати їх у реальні об'єкти дати. Це відбувається через ORM Django, тому я не можу використовувати SQL для …
2179 python  datetime 


12
Як отримати підрядок рядка в Python?
Чи є спосіб замінити рядок у Python, щоб отримати нову рядок від третього символу до кінця рядка? Може, як myString[2:end]? Якщо вийти з другої частини означає «до кінця», а якщо ви залишите першу частину, це починається з початку?
2143 python  string  substring 



10
Чому "1000000000000000 в діапазоні (1000000000000001)" так швидко на Python 3?
Наскільки я розумію, що range()функція, яка є фактично типом об'єкта в Python 3 , генерує його вміст на льоту, подібно до генератора. У цьому випадку я б очікував, що наступний рядок забирає непомірний проміжок часу, оскільки для того, щоб визначити, чи є 1 квадрильйон у діапазоні, слід було б генерувати …

23
Чи є спосіб запустити Python на Android?
Відповіді на це запитання - це зусилля громади . Відредагуйте наявні відповіді, щоб покращити цю публікацію. Наразі не приймає нових відповідей чи взаємодій. Ми працюємо над версією S60, і ця платформа має приємний API Python .. Тим не менш, немає нічого офіційного в Python на Android, але оскільки Jython існує, …

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.